4) Wolf Pack Dynamics

A dominant wolf leads the pack through a dense forest, while others follow in a unified and organized formation

When it comes to wolf pack dynamics, there’s no denying that it’s a complex and fascinating subject. Wolves are social animals, and they form tight-knit family groups known as packs. These packs are led by an alpha male and female, who are typically the parents of the other wolves in the pack.

The alpha male and female are responsible for leading the pack, making decisions, and protecting their territory. They’re also the only wolves in the pack that mate and have offspring. The other wolves in the pack, known as subordinates, are responsible for hunting and caring for the young.

While the alpha wolves have a lot of power and influence, they’re not necessarily aggressive or dominant. In fact, they often use subtle cues and body language to communicate with the other wolves in the pack. For example, a dominant wolf might stand tall and hold its tail high, while a submissive wolf might crouch down and tuck its tail between its legs.

Overall, wolf pack dynamics are a fascinating subject that continues to intrigue scientists and animal lovers alike. By studying these animals and their behavior, we can gain a better understanding of their complex social structures and the important role they play in the ecosystem.

Understanding Wolf Anatomy

A wolf standing in a natural setting, showing the muscular structure and fur texture. The wolf's head is turned slightly to the side, with alert eyes and pointed ears

Head Structure

The head of a wolf is one of its most distinctive features. It is large and powerful, with a strong jaw and sharp teeth. The wolf’s ears are also very important, as they are used for communication and hunting. They are pointed and can be moved independently, allowing the wolf to locate the source of a sound with great accuracy. The eyes of a wolf are also very important, as they are used for hunting and communication. They are large and have excellent night vision, allowing the wolf to hunt in low light conditions.

Body Proportions

The body of a wolf is designed for speed and agility. It is long and lean, with powerful muscles and a flexible spine. The legs are long and strong, allowing the wolf to run at high speeds for extended periods of time. The feet are also very important, as they are used for traction and balance. They have large pads and sharp claws, which help the wolf grip the ground and make quick turns.

Overall, understanding wolf anatomy is essential for anyone who wants to draw these magnificent animals. By studying the head structure and body proportions, artists can create accurate and realistic drawings that capture the essence of the wolf’s beauty and power.

Techniques for Capturing Fur Texture

A wolf standing in a forest, its fur ruffled by the wind. Sunlight filters through the trees, casting dappled shadows on its coat

Capturing the texture of fur can be a challenging task, but with the right techniques, it can be achieved. Here are some tips to help you capture the essence of fur in your wolf drawings:

1. Use Light and Shade

Light and shade play a significant role in creating the illusion of fur texture. Use shading techniques to create depth and give the fur a three-dimensional appearance. Use lighter shades to create highlights and darker shades to create shadows.

2. Layering

Layering is a technique that involves building layers of color to create depth and texture. Start with a light base layer and gradually add darker colors to create the illusion of depth and texture.

3. Use Different Pencil Strokes

Experiment with different pencil strokes to create different textures. Use short, quick strokes to create a soft, fuzzy texture, and long, curved strokes to create a sleek, shiny texture.

4. Observe Real-Life Examples

Observing real-life examples of wolf fur can help you understand how fur behaves and how light interacts with it. Look at photographs or visit a zoo to observe wolves up close.

5. Practice, Practice, Practice

Practice is key to mastering any skill, including capturing fur texture in wolf drawings. Keep practicing and experimenting with different techniques until you find what works best for you.

By using these techniques, you can capture the texture of fur in your wolf drawings and bring them to life.
